Understanding the Value of ACCA in Today’s World

The ACCA (Association of Chartered Certified Accountants) qualification is one of the most recognized credentials in the field of accounting and finance. It is designed to develop strong technical knowledge, professional skills, and ethical understanding required in global business environments.

In today’s competitive market, organizations seek finance professionals who can manage financial reporting, strategic planning, and compliance responsibilities. The ACCA qualification prepares students to meet these expectations by offering a comprehensive curriculum that focuses on practical and analytical abilities.


ACCA Course Structure and Learning Approach

ACCA course details are highlighted for their well-structured framework that guides students step by step through essential finance and accounting subjects. The program is divided into different levels, allowing learners to gradually build their knowledge and skills.

Each stage of the course focuses on developing core competencies such as financial accounting, management accounting, taxation, audit, and business strategy. This structured progression ensures that students gain both theoretical understanding and practical application skills throughout their learning journey.
